目前,我们使用Plone 3.3.5与Ploneboard 2.2,我们在我们的网站上有几个不同主题的论坛。有时用户在错误的论坛中发布他们的消息,我们希望将这些线程移动到适当的论坛。不幸的是,这不起作用。
更确切地说: 在论坛“A”中显示主题“xyz”时,我可以使用Actions> Cut下拉菜单获取“xyz”被剪切的消息。但它没有发生,“xyz”仍然在论坛“A”。当我随后使用论坛“B”中的操作>粘贴下拉菜单时,我收到不允许粘贴页面的消息。当我在论坛“B”的主题“abc”中做同样的事情时,没有任何反应。
我的问题是,如果Ploneboard被设计为在一个论坛中剪切一个帖子并将其粘贴到另一个论坛中,或者如果根本没有提供此功能。
我们计划升级到Plone 4.是否可以在更新版本的Ploneboard中将线程从一个论坛移动到另一个论坛?如果没有,是否有其他留言板/论坛解决方案具有此功能?
答案 0 :(得分:3)
我发现了同样的问题。 对于Plone 3.3.x,我开发了这个产品:Products.PloneboardPasteObject 你可以在pypi上找到它:http://pypi.python.org/pypi/Products.PloneboardPasteObject
答案 1 :(得分:0)
我建议启动Plone 4的测试实例并尝试最新版本的Ploneboard(3.3)。因为线程只是内容对象,所以我不认为Ploneboard需要做任何特别的事情来“支持”剪切和粘贴线程。所以,我的猜测是,A)它是一个bug,可能会在更新的版本中修复,或者B)有一些深层原因导致无法支持这种情况,在这种情况下它不太可能在最新版本。
答案 2 :(得分:0)
Ploneboard
允许PloneboardForum
。 PloneboardForum允许PloneboardConversation
。 PloneboardConversation允许PloneboardComment
s。
见:
了解更多信息。特别是,请参阅上述每种类型的以下属性(这个属性来自Ploneboard.xml):
<property name="filter_content_types">True</property>
<property name="allowed_content_types">
<element value="PloneboardForum"/>
</property>
您只能将对象粘贴到允许您尝试粘贴的对象类型的其他对象中。 Plone的工作原理,而不是Ploneboard特定的。
Re:Plone 4.升级不会改变这个基本的Plone功能。
Re:其他Plone论坛软件:使用其他论坛软件不会改变这个基本的Plone功能,可能除了定义不同内容类型和约束的其他论坛软件外。